How to choose your 2x12-inch guitar cabinet?
2x12-inch guitar cabinets play a central role for guitarists looking for a compromise between sound power and ease of transport. This format is particularly well suited to rehearsals and concerts, offering broader sound projection than a 1x12 cabinet while remaining more manageable than a 4x12. It delivers a balanced sound capable of adapting to different styles and amplifier configurations.
When selecting a 2x12 cabinet, it is essential to check its power handling to ensure it matches that of your amplifier, thereby avoiding unwanted distortion. The type and quality of the speakers influence the accuracy and dynamics of the reproduced sound. Weight and dimensions play a key role in transport, while the cabinet’s sturdiness and connections ensure reliable use both in rehearsals and concerts.
